> > First, a dummy /usr/bin/perldoc executable is provided by the perl
> > Ubuntu package. This perldoc script contains only the following:
> >
> > #!/bin/sh
> > # place-holder, diverted by perl-doc
> > echo You need to install the perl-doc package to use this program. >&2
> > exit 1
> >
> > So the call to TeXLive::TLUtils::which("perldoc") returns
> > "/usr/bin/perldoc" and therefore the noperldoc option is set to 0.
> > [...]
>
> It seems to be sufficient look to into the perldoc file and determine
> from the shebang line whether it's a Perl or Shell script. The "real"
> perldoc script begins with #!/usr/bin/perl .
